Claims
- 1. A dental vacuum system for use in dental operatories comprising:
a vacuum means for the generation of an air stream and a control means for said vacuum means, said vacuum means in communication with an aspirator tip positioned within a patient's oral cavity, said aspirator tip for the removal of fluids, solid debris and air from the oral cavity by said air stream, there being disposed between said aspirator tip and said vacuum means; a separation means for the separation of fluids and solid debris from the air stream, said separation means comprising a container having a cylindrical side wall, a decreasing diameter base member having a fluid outlet in communication with a drain, an open top having a lid securable thereto, an inlet means for the introduction of said fluid, said debris, and said air stream into said separation chamber, and an exit means for the evacuation of said air stream to the vacuum means; said exit means comprising a conduit in communication with said vacuum means, said conduit positioned through said side wall of said container proximate said lid, said conduit having an exit port formed thereon, said exit port oriented upwardly toward said lid, said conduit having secured thereto a pivot arm having a first end and a second said pivot arm having a sealing means at said first end of said pivot arm cooperable with said exit port for sealing said exit port, said pivot arm having a float means depending downwardly from said second end of said pivot arm, said downward dependency of said float means being adjustable, said float means reactive to said fluid level to pivot said pivot arm to seal said exit port.

- 7. A separation chamber for use in a dental vacuum system for the separation of fluids and debris from an air stream drawn by a vacuum means, said separation chamber comprising:
a cylindrical body member defined by a side wall having an interior surface and an exterior surface, an upper end and a lower end; a decreasing diameter base member secured to said lower end of said cylindrical body member terminating in a drain orifice; a lid means removably secured to said upper end of said cylindrical body member; inlet means for the introduction of an air stream containing fluids and debris; an outlet means for the evacuation of said air stream from said separation chamber, said outlet means comprising an outlet conduit with outlet port, said outlet port oriented upwardly in the direction of said lid of said separation chamber; a sealing means for said outlet port, said sealing means comprising a pivot arm mounted on a pivot point, said pivot point mounted to said conduit, said pivot arm having a first end and a second end, said first end having positioned thereon a seal cooperative with said outlet port to seal said outlet port, said second end of said pivot arm having an adjustable float means depending from said second end, said float means reactive to resistance to operate said pivot arm about said pivot point to bring said seal in cooperative sealing with said outlet port to seal same.
